About the Book
This insightful work by James Kynge presents a sharp and engaging analysis of China’s extraordinary economic transformation. The book explores how China rapidly evolved into a global industrial powerhouse, reshaping manufacturing, trade, and the balance of economic power worldwide.
Through detailed reporting and on-the-ground observations, the author examines the forces driving China’s export boom, its impact on Western economies, and the social and political changes accompanying this rapid growth. The narrative highlights both the opportunities and tensions created by China’s rise in the global marketplace.
